What waterblock do you use?

I use ek supreme vga block but with swiftech mcw80/82 mounting screw/nuts. the ek screw are too short, but the swiftech one is longer. however you can just get a same thread screw from homedepot and thumb nuts , then use ek VGA block. also i'm using stock vga backplate. make sure you have fans blow onto the stock vrm/ram heatsink, otherwise it will heat up to 100c. you can get a pci bracket like this to mount 2x120mm quiet fan to get some airflow on to the heatsink
